Teleforge API Reference - v0.1.0
Preparing search index...
bff/src
BffConfig
Interface BffConfig<TAppUser>
interface
BffConfig
<
TAppUser
extends
AppUser
=
AppUser
>
{
adapters
:
Readonly
<
{
cache
?:
BffCacheAdapter
;
identity
:
IdentityAdapter
<
TAppUser
>
;
session
?:
SessionAdapter
;
}
,
>
;
events
:
SessionSecurityEventSink
|
null
;
features
:
Readonly
<
BffFeatureFlags
>
;
identity
:
Readonly
<
BffIdentityConfig
<
TAppUser
>
>
;
jwt
:
Readonly
<
BffJwtConfig
|
null
>
;
options
:
Readonly
<
BffResolvedConfigOptions
<
TAppUser
>
>
;
services
:
Readonly
<
ServiceMap
>
;
validation
:
Readonly
<
BffValidationConfig
>
;
createRouter
()
:
BffRouter
;
validate
()
:
true
;
}
Type Parameters
TAppUser
extends
AppUser
=
AppUser
Index
Methods
create
Router
validate
Properties
adapters
events
features
identity
jwt
options
services
validation
Methods
create
Router
createRouter
()
:
BffRouter
Returns
BffRouter
validate
validate
()
:
true
Returns
true
Properties
Readonly
adapters
adapters
:
Readonly
<
{
cache
?:
BffCacheAdapter
;
identity
:
IdentityAdapter
<
TAppUser
>
;
session
?:
SessionAdapter
;
}
,
>
Readonly
events
events
:
SessionSecurityEventSink
|
null
Readonly
features
features
:
Readonly
<
BffFeatureFlags
>
Readonly
identity
identity
:
Readonly
<
BffIdentityConfig
<
TAppUser
>
>
Readonly
jwt
jwt
:
Readonly
<
BffJwtConfig
|
null
>
Readonly
options
options
:
Readonly
<
BffResolvedConfigOptions
<
TAppUser
>
>
Readonly
services
services
:
Readonly
<
ServiceMap
>
Readonly
validation
validation
:
Readonly
<
BffValidationConfig
>
Settings
Member Visibility
Inherited
Theme
OS
Light
Dark
On This Page
Methods
create
Router
validate
Properties
adapters
events
features
identity
jwt
options
services
validation
Teleforge API Reference - v0.1.0
Loading...